云计算技术的快速发展,不仅改变了企业的运营模式,也为档案馆的管理和服务带来了革命性的变革。本文将深入探讨云计算如何革新档案馆,特别是在海量数据管理方面的应用。
一、云计算与档案馆的契合点
1.1 数据存储与管理
档案馆的主要任务之一是存储和管理大量的历史数据。云计算提供了弹性的存储解决方案,可以按需扩展,满足档案馆不断增长的数据存储需求。
1.2 数据访问与共享
云计算平台使得档案馆的数据可以更便捷地被内部和外部用户访问,促进了信息的共享和交流。
1.3 成本效益
传统的档案馆需要大量的硬件设备和专业人员来维护,而云计算通过减少物理设备投资和降低人力成本,为档案馆带来了显著的效益。
二、云计算在档案馆的应用
2.1 海量数据存储
云计算提供了多种存储服务,如对象存储、文件存储和块存储。档案馆可以根据数据类型和访问模式选择合适的存储服务。
# 示例:使用Amazon S3进行对象存储
import boto3
s3 = boto3.client('s3')
response = s3.create_bucket(Bucket='archive-data')
print(response)
2.2 数据备份与恢复
云计算平台通常提供数据备份和恢复服务,确保档案馆数据的安全性和可靠性。
# 示例:使用AWS Backup进行数据备份
import boto3
backup = boto3.client('backup')
response = backup.create_backup_plan(
BackupPlanName='ArchiveBackupPlan',
BackupPlanRule={
'TargetBackupVaultArn': 'arn:aws:backup:region:account-id:vault:backup-vault-id',
'Lifecycle': {
'Transition': {
'DaysAfterCreation': 30,
'ToBackupVault': 'arn:aws:backup:region:account-id:vault:transition-vault-id'
},
'Retention': {
'DaysAfterTransition': 365
}
}
}
)
print(response)
2.3 数据分析与挖掘
云计算平台上的大数据分析工具可以帮助档案馆对海量数据进行深入挖掘,发现有价值的信息。
# 示例:使用Apache Spark进行数据分析
from pyspark.sql import SparkSession
spark = SparkSession.builder \
.appName("ArchiveDataAnalysis") \
.getOrCreate()
# 加载数据
data = spark.read.csv("s3://archive-data/records.csv", header=True, inferSchema=True)
# 数据分析
results = data.groupBy("category").count().orderBy("count", ascending=False)
# 显示结果
results.show()
三、云计算带来的挑战与应对策略
3.1 数据安全与隐私
云计算环境下,数据安全与隐私保护是档案馆面临的重要挑战。档案馆应采取严格的数据加密、访问控制和审计措施来确保数据安全。
3.2 网络带宽与延迟
对于需要频繁访问大量数据的档案馆,网络带宽和延迟可能成为瓶颈。档案馆应选择具有良好网络性能的云服务提供商,并优化数据访问策略。
3.3 人员培训与技能提升
云计算技术的应用需要档案馆工作人员具备相应的技能。档案馆应加强人员培训,提升员工的云计算技术应用能力。
四、结论
云计算为档案馆带来了前所未有的机遇,特别是在海量数据管理方面。通过合理利用云计算技术,档案馆可以更好地存储、管理和利用数据,为历史研究和文化传承做出更大贡献。